There were 2,214 gasoline stations in California that had between one and four employees in 2016, according to County Business Patterns (CBP) statistics provided by the United States Census Bureau.
CBP data indicates that there are more establishments categorized as professional, scientific and technical services businesses with between one and four employees in California than in any other category.
